Building permits are a vital facet of the construction and renovation process, performing as a authorized requirement that ensures compliance with local codes and regulations. When a person or a business plans to undertake any construction, they must search approval from the native government. This process not solely protects public safety but additionally helps maintain the structural integrity of buildings in the surrounding community.


The software for a building permit requires detailed plans that define the proposed work. These plans include architectural designs, structural considerations, and generally environmental impacts. When stuffed out appropriately, the permit application helps native officials perceive each the scope of the project and its implications for the neighborhood.


Upon submission, relevant authorities will evaluation the appliance to ensure it aligns with zoning legal guidelines, safety standards, and different laws - Versatile contractors for various projects Burbank, CA. This evaluate process typically includes checking for adherence to building codes that dictate the minimal requirements for construction practices. Local codes make positive that constructions are safe and habitable, stopping potential hazards similar to fire threat or structural weakness

Once the application is permitted, a building permit is issued. This document grants permission to commence construction whereas also outlining what can and can't be carried out. It serves as a guideline for each the contractors involved and the inspectors who will later confirm that the project adheres to the approved plans.


During construction, ongoing inspections might be required to watch compliance with the permit conditions. These inspections can cowl various elements, including plumbing methods, electrical installations, and structural integrity. Ensuring adherence to the permit throughout the development process minimizes the danger of future complications, both for the builder and the occupants.

Failing to obtain or adjust to a building permit can result in critical penalties, together with fines, cessation of labor, and even legal actions. Local governments have the authority to enforce building codes rigorously, which can include requiring the demolition of a structure that was built without proper permits. This unpredictability makes it essential for anyone considering construction to prioritize obtaining their permits.


The costs associated with building permits can differ extensively, relying on the project's dimension, kind, and placement. Fees are sometimes tiered primarily based on particular standards, making it crucial for householders and contractors to grasp the breakdown. Additionally, some localities could provide sources or payment waivers to encourage sure kinds of improvement, similar to affordable housing tasks.


In many instances, building permits can also have an impact on the overall timeline of a project. For these planning to construct or renovate, understanding the allowing process is significant. Delays in permit approval can push back begin dates, which, in flip, can affect every thing from scheduling contractors to budgeting for costs.


Moreover, engaging with the community is often an integral part of the permit course of. Public hearings might occur, during which neighbors can specific their issues or help for a project. This added layer of input helps to take care of the character of current neighborhoods and fosters goodwill amongst future neighbors.

Building permits are not solely for model new construction but in addition cowl renovations, repairs, and even sure alterations to present constructions. Whether it's adding a deck, ending a basement, or changing the exterior facade, acquiring the right permits ensures that these modifications adjust to existing laws and requirements.


In many areas, there are various kinds of permits based mostly on varied criteria. These can embrace common building permits, electrical permits, plumbing permits, and extra, each with its own software necessities and processes. Expert recommendations for contractors Calabasas, CA. Understanding which allows are necessary for a given project can save time, effort, and financial assets

    What is a building permit and why do I need one?



A building permit is an official approval issued by your native government that lets you proceed with construction or renovation projects. It ensures that your project adheres to native zoning laws, building codes, and safety laws. Obtaining a permit is crucial to avoid authorized issues and potential fines.

How lengthy does it take to get a building permit?


The timeframe for acquiring a building permit can range broadly based on your location, the complexity of the project, and the volume of applications the building department is handling. Generally, it can take anywhere from a number of days to a number of weeks. Planning ahead can help avoid any unnecessary delays.

What happens during the building permit review process?


During the building permit review course of, your submitted plans and utility will be evaluated by native officers to make sure compliance with building codes, zoning rules, and safety requirements. They could request adjustments or extra info earlier than deciding whether or not to approve or deny the permit.

Are there fees associated with acquiring a building permit?


Yes, most jurisdictions cost a payment for processing building permit purposes. The amount can depend on the type of project, its dimension, and native laws. It's advisable to inquire concerning the total costs concerned when submitting your utility to keep away from surprises.


What are the results of not having a building permit?


Failure to obtain a building permit can result in fines, pressured removal of unpermitted work, or legal motion. Additionally, not having a permit can complicate future property transactions and have an result on insurance protection, as unpermitted work could not meet safety requirements.

What should I do if my building permit is denied?


If your building permit is denied, you will obtain a notice outlining the reasons for the denial. You can appropriate the problems identified, revise your plans accordingly, and reapply. Alternatively, you may also enchantment the decision, depending on native laws.
